Population Comparison: Clarksville vs Dubuque

  • The population in Dubuque is higher at 58,873, compared to 9,555 in Clarksville.
  • The median age in Dubuque is higher at 37.9 years, compared to 35.3 years in Clarksville.
  • Dubuque has a higher median income of $63,520, compared to $35,911 in Clarksville.
  • In Dubuque, the percentage of married families is higher at 37.0%, compared to 36.0% in Clarksville.
  • Clarksville has a higher poverty level at 18% compared to 10% in Dubuque.
  • The unemployment rate in Clarksville is higher at 4.5%, compared to 3.0% in Dubuque.

Health Statistics Comparison: Clarksville vs Dubuque

  • More residents in Clarksville report poor mental health at 21.0% compared to 15.6% in Dubuque.
  • Depression is more prevalent in Clarksville at 27.9% compared to 18.5% in Dubuque.
  • Smoking is more prevalent in Clarksville at 24.5% compared to 16.9% in Dubuque.
  • More residents engage in binge drinking in Dubuque at 21.6% compared to 13.9% in Clarksville.
  • Obesity rates are higher in Clarksville at 39.7% compared to 33.9% in Dubuque.
  • Disability percentages are higher in Clarksville at 20.0% compared to 13.0% in Dubuque.
